Canada Study Visa Fees from India 2026 (Government Charges)
The first cost you will incur is the official Canada study permit fee, which is paid to IRCC (Immigration, Refugees and Citizenship Canada).
Visa Fee Breakdown (2026)
Study Permit Fee: CAD 150 (~₹13,500)
Biometrics Fee: CAD 85 (~₹7,650)
👉 Total Visa Fees: CAD 235 (~₹21,000)
This is the minimum mandatory cost, and it is non-refundable once you apply.

Medical Exam & Additional Visa Costs
Apart from government fees, there are additional mandatory and optional charges:
Medical Examination: ₹5,000 – ₹50,000 (depending on clinic)
Police Clearance Certificate: ₹500 – ₹1,000
VAC (Visa Application Centre) Charges: ₹1,500 – ₹3,000
Passport & Documentation: ₹2,000 – ₹5,000
👉 Estimated Additional Cost: ₹10,000 – ₹60,000
GIC Amount for Canada Study Visa 2026 (Most Important)
The Guaranteed Investment Certificate (GIC) is a mandatory financial requirement for most Indian students.
Latest GIC Requirement
Minimum GIC: CAD 20,635 (~₹12–13 lakh)
This amount is used to cover your first-year living expenses in Canada.
👉 Important:
You will receive this money monthly after reaching Canada
It proves to the visa officer that you can survive financially
Tuition Fees in Canada for Indian Students 2026
Tuition fees vary based on course and college, but here is the average:
Average Tuition Fees
Bachelor’s Degree: CAD 36,100/year (~₹23–24 lakh)
Master’s Degree: CAD 21,100/year (~₹13–14 lakh)
Diploma Courses: ₹8 – ₹15 lakh/year
Professional courses like MBA, Engineering, or Medical programs are more expensive.
Living Expenses in Canada (2026 Updated)
The Canadian government has increased financial requirements significantly.
Minimum Living Cost
Required Proof: CAD 20,635/year
Realistic Living Cost
Monthly Expenses: CAD 1,200 – CAD 2,000
Yearly Cost: CAD 15,000 – CAD 25,000
Cities like Toronto and Vancouver are more expensive compared to smaller cities.
Total Cost to Study in Canada from India 2026
Now let’s calculate the complete cost breakdown:
Total Estimated Budget (1st Year)
Expense Type | Cost (INR) |
Visa Fees | ₹21,000 |
Medical & Other | ₹20,000 – ₹60,000 |
GIC | ₹12 – ₹13 lakh |
Tuition Fees | ₹10 – ₹25 lakh |
Air Ticket | ₹1 – ₹1.5 lakh |
👉 Total Cost: ₹25 lakh to ₹40 lakh (approx.)

Proof of Funds Requirement (Very Important for Visa Approval)
Canada study visa rejection rates are high, especially for Indian students. One of the biggest reasons is improper financial proof.
Minimum Funds Required
You must show:
1st Year Tuition Fees
Living Expenses (CAD 20,635)
Travel Cost (~CAD 2,000)
👉 Total Funds Required: CAD 38,000 – CAD 48,000

Hidden Costs You Should Not Ignore
Many students only calculate tuition and visa fees but ignore hidden costs:
IELTS Test Fee: ₹16,000 – ₹17,000
Application Fees (Colleges): ₹5,000 – ₹15,000 per college
Flight Tickets: ₹80,000 – ₹1.5 lakh
Winter Clothes & Setup: ₹50,000+
Accommodation Deposit: ₹1 – ₹2 lakh
👉 These can increase your total cost significantly.
How to Reduce Canada Study Visa Cost
Here are some practical tips:
Choose Affordable Colleges
Diploma colleges are cheaper than universities.
Apply for Scholarships
Many Canadian institutions offer partial scholarships.
Work Part-Time
Students can work up to 24 hours per week (as per latest updates).
Select Budget-Friendly Cities
Cities like Winnipeg, Halifax, and Saskatoon are cheaper.
